Mission Village
Enjoy the hassle-free condominium lifestyle from the central location of Mission Valley!
Everything that beautiful San Diego has to offer is right at the doorstep of your condominium at Mission Village.
Mission Village, built in 1972, is a community of 256 units in zip code 92108 in the central section of Mission Valley. Units range in size from 419 to 1,030 square feet, and bedroom/bathroom floor plans include 0/1, 1/1, and 2/2. The studio units are very popular with pilots and flight attendants, as well as companies needing to bring people in for short stays, especially since cable/TV is included in the HOA fees.
Amenities at Mission Village include on-site guard, swimming pool, sauna, spa, tennis court, fitness center, clubhouse/recreation room, outdoor grills, and common laundry.
HOA fees range from about $196 to $420 per month and include common area maintenance, exterior building and roof maintenance, landscaping, cable/TV, gas, water (including hot water), sewer, trash pickup, and limited insurance.
Mission Village is easily accessible to Qualcomm Stadium, the University of San Diego, San Diego State University, Fashion Valley Mall, several San Diego Trolley stations, SeaWorld, Mission Bay, Old Town, and downtown San Diego.
Walkers, joggers, and bikers will enjoy the concrete paths along the San Diego River from Qualcomm Stadium on the east end of Mission Valley all the way to Mission Bay, Ocean Beach, and Mission Beach on the west end, a distance of about seven miles.
Mission Village is managed by Curtis Management. Contact them at 858-587-9844.
A check with the FHA indicates that Mission Village had been FHA approved but the approval expired on July 31, 2011. No word yet on whether or not approval was renewed. Mission Village is not VA approved.
